Flat roof replacement services involve removing an existing flat roof and installing a new, durable roofing system. This process typically includes inspecting the current roof, preparing the surface, and carefully installing new materials designed to withstand weather exposure and daily wear. Professional service providers ensure that the new flat roof is properly sealed and secured to prevent leaks, improve energy efficiency, and extend the lifespan of the property’s roofing system.

These services help address common problems such as persistent leaks, ponding water, and roof deterioration caused by age or damage. Over time, flat roofs can develop cracks, blisters, or areas where the roofing material has become compromised, leading to water infiltration and potential structural issues. Replacing an aging or damaged flat roof can restore the building’s integrity, prevent further damage, and reduce the risk of costly repairs in the future.

Flat roof replacement is often needed for commercial buildings, multi-family housing, and some residential properties with flat or low-slope roofs. These types of properties benefit from the practicality and cost-efficiency of flat roofing systems, which offer easy access for maintenance and installation of additional features like HVAC units or solar panels. Homeowners with flat roofs on extensions, garages, or secondary structures may also consider replacement services to improve safety and functionality.

Choosing to replace a flat roof is a practical decision when signs of aging or damage become evident. Common indicators include visible cracks, persistent leaks, water pooling, or widespread surface deterioration. The overview below groups typical Flat Roof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or flat roof repairs generally range from $250-$600, covering patching small leaks or replacing sections.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ching the higher end.

Partial Replacement - when only part of a flat roof needs replacement, costs usually range from $2,000-$5,000 depending on the size and materials used. Larger, more complex partial projects can sometimes exceed this range.

Full Replacement - complete flat roof replacements typically cost between $5,000 and $15,000, influenced by roof size, material choices, and accessibility. Most full replacements fall into the middle to upper part of this range.

Complex or Large-Scale Projects - extensive or highly customized flat roof replacements can reach $20,000 or more, especially for large commercial properties or intricate designs. These projects are less common but represent the top tier of potential costs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are signs that a flat roof needs replacement? Indicators include persistent leaks, visible damage or cracks, pooling water, or significant aging of the roofing material.

Can a flat roof be repaired instead of replaced? Yes, some issues can be addressed through repairs, but extensive damage or age-related wear may require a full replacement by local contractors.

What types of flat roofing materials are available for replacement? Common options include membrane systems like EPDM, TPO, and PVC, each offering different benefits suited to various building needs.

How do local service providers handle flat roof replacements? They typically assess the existing roof, recommend suitable materials, and perform the replacement following industry standards.
